This episode explores the concept of belief in God within Judaism, emphasizing knowledge over blind faith and its implications for living.

What does Judaism really mean when it talks about “belief in God”? In this episode, we explore why the Torah doesn’t ask for blind faith—but for knowledge —and how that changes the way we live. The difference between belief and knowledge, and why it matters Sinai as a national experience—and why Judaism’s foundation is unique How belief becomes something lived, not just discussed
